
Fields of Tulip With The Rijnsburg Windmill
Claude Monet’s Fields of Tulip with the Rijnsburg Windmill (1886) captures the vibrant beauty of tulip fields in full bloom, with rows of red, yellow, and white flowers stretching across the Dutch countryside. At the center of the composition, the Rijnsburg windmill rises against a bright, cloud-filled sky, serving as a focal point that anchors the colorful landscape. Monet’s loose, dynamic brushstrokes convey the movement of the wind through the flowers and the spinning sails of the windmill, while his palette emphasizes the interplay between the saturated hues of the tulips and the soft, natural tones of the sky and surrounding structures. The scene reflects Monet’s fascination with light and color, as well as his interest in exploring the landscapes and cultural elements of the regions he visited.
